# php-base - PHP Slim 4 Server library for OpenAPI Petstore * [OpenAPI Generator](https://openapi-generator.tech) * [Slim 4 Documentation](https://www.slimframework.com/docs/v4/) This server has been generated with [Slim PSR-7](https://github.com/slimphp/Slim-Psr7) implementation. ## Requirements * Web server with URL rewriting * PHP 7.2 or newer This package contains `.htaccess` for Apache configuration. If you use another server(Nginx, HHVM, IIS, lighttpd) check out [Web Servers](https://www.slimframework.com/docs/v3/start/web-servers.html) doc. ## Installation via [Composer](https://getcomposer.org/) Navigate into your project's root directory and execute the bash command shown below. This command downloads the Slim Framework and its third-party dependencies into your project's `vendor/` directory. ```bash $ composer install ``` ## Add configs Application requires at least one config file(`config/dev/config.inc.php` or `config/prod/config.inc.php`). You can use [config/dev/example.inc.php](config/dev/example.inc.php) as starting point. ## Start devserver Run the following command in terminal to start localhost web server, assuming `./php-slim-server/` is public-accessible directory with `index.php` file: ```bash $ php -S localhost:8888 -t php-slim-server ``` > **Warning** This web server was designed to aid application development. > It may also be useful for testing purposes or for application demonstrations that are run in controlled environments. > It is not intended to be a full-featured web server. It should not be used on a public network. ## Tests ### PHPUnit This package uses PHPUnit 8 or 9(depends from your PHP version) for unit testing. The Command-Line Test Runner — PHPUnit 8.5 Manual](https://phpunit.readthedocs.io/en/8.5/textui.html#command-line-options): > If phpunit.xml or phpunit.xml.dist (in that order) exist in the current working directory and --configuration is not used, the configuration will be automatically read from that file. ### PHP CodeSniffer [PHP CodeSniffer Documentation](https://github.com/squizlabs/PHP_CodeSniffer/wiki). This tool helps to follow coding style and avoid common PHP coding mistakes. #### Run ```bash $ composer phpcs ``` #### Config Package contains fully functional config `./phpcs.xml.dist` file. It checks source code against PSR-1 and PSR-2 coding standards. Create `./phpcs.xml` in root folder to override it. More info at [Using a Default Configuration File](https://github.com/squizlabs/PHP_CodeSniffer/wiki/Advanced-Usage#using-a-default-configuration-file) ### PHPLint [PHPLint Documentation](https://github.com/overtrue/phplint). Checks PHP syntax only. #### Run ```bash $ composer phplint ``` ## Show errors Switch on option in your application config file like: ```diff return [ 'slimSettings' => [ - 'displayErrorDetails' => false, + 'displayErrorDetails' => true, 'logErrors' => true, 'logErrorDetails' => true, ], ``` ## Mock Server For a quick start uncomment [mocker middleware options](config/dev/example.inc.php#L67-L94) in your application config file. Used packages: * [Openapi Data Mocker](https://github.com/ybelenko/openapi-data-mocker) - first implementation of OAS3 fake data generator. * [Openapi Data Mocker Server Middleware](https://github.com/ybelenko/openapi-data-mocker-server-middleware) - PSR-15 HTTP server middleware. * [Openapi Data Mocker Interfaces](https://github.com/ybelenko/openapi-data-mocker-interfaces) - package with mocking interfaces. ## API Endpoints All URIs are relative to *http://petstore.swagger.io/v2* > Important! Do not modify abstract API controllers directly! Instead extend them by implementation classes like: ```php // src/Api/PetApi.php namespace OpenAPIServer\Api; use OpenAPIServer\Api\AbstractPetApi; class PetApi extends AbstractPetApi { public function addPet($request, $response, $args) { // your implementation of addPet method here } } ``` Place all your implementation classes in `./src` folder accordingly. For instance, when abstract class located at `./lib/Api/AbstractPetApi.php` you need to create implementation class at `./src/Api/PetApi.php`. To make ApiKey authentication work you need to extend [\OpenAPIServer\Auth\AbstractAuthenticator](./lib/Auth/AbstractAuthenticator.php) class by [\OpenAPIServer\Auth\ApiKeyAuthenticator](./src/Auth/ApiKeyAuthenticator.php) class. ### Security schema `petstore_auth` > Important! To make OAuth authentication work you need to extend [\OpenAPIServer\Auth\AbstractAuthenticator](./lib/Auth/AbstractAuthenticator.php) class by [\OpenAPIServer\Auth\OAuthAuthenticator](./src/Auth/OAuthAuthenticator.php) class. Scope list: * `write:pets` - modify pets in your account * `read:pets` - read your pets ### Advanced middleware configuration Ref to used Slim Token Middleware [dyorg/slim-token-authentication](https://github.com/dyorg/slim-token-authentication/tree/1.x#readme)
